Anyone with the money to attempt a turbo install should be able to finance this effort.

The tuning and adjustment is the same for any turbo install.

I believe anyone capable of comprehending the concepts of turbocharging can comprehend the concepts of turbocharging a high compression engine. A 10:1 CR engine can be safely turbo'ed as long as the boost is limited to 5-6 psi. A safety system to prevent detonation such as water injection (or a water-to-air intercooler) can be installed.

You speak of it as being impossible and exorbitantly expensive. It isn't.
